Asbestos, once widely used in manufacturing and construction for its strength, durability, and resistance to heat and fire, remains the subject of lawsuits. Following the first asbestos- related lawsuit in 1966, hundreds of thousands of claims have been filed, forcing 73 companies into bankruptcy by mid- 2004. Asbestos liability looks to be one of the largest liabilities ever faced by U.S. businesses4 For the US. Insurance industry, asbestos-related losses could eventually reach as much as $65 billion. By the late 1990s, claims appeared to have stabilized, but then surged again.
